Output 30d84c14f536bba39c4f34daa8dee33c2a148958161defd1d5ef93e2ea081d90:0

value
93453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d9e632ea1c7c2021858e355565cf02f9cb8ad6 OP_EQUAL
address
31mWxSramKDrA47rhnuYsTA3NSQzXP8yYd
transaction
30d84c14f536bba39c4f34daa8dee33c2a148958161defd1d5ef93e2ea081d90
spent
true